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 vs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o
Comparing the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 vs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o across performance, display, camera, battery, storage and user rating to help determine the better smartphone.
Here is the summary of the results:
Performance: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o runs at a higher processing speed of 0.67 GHz, while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 runs at 0.6 GHz, making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o the better performer.
Display: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o offers a screen size of 3.2 inches, while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 offers 3 inches, making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o the larger display of the two. Both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 and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o feature the same LCD display.
Rear Camera: Both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 and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o feature a 3.2 MP primary rear camera.
Battery: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o offers a higher battery capacity with 1500 mAh, while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 offers 1200 mAh, making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o better for longer battery life.
Storage: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o offers higher internal storage with 512 GB, while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 offers 128 GB, making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o the better option for storage.
User Rating: Samsung I5801 Galaxy Apollo receives a higher user rating of 3.6, while Sony Ericsson XPERIA X8 has a rating of 2.8.
